In 1736, Reverend John Cole entered the world in Orange, Orange, Virginia, United States, born to John Cole And Mary Ann Mullins. Reverend John Cole married Elizabeth, Elizabeth Dodgen, Elizabeth Smith, Mary Golding, and had children including Anna Cole, Elizabeth Betsy Cole, Frances Cole, James Cole, John Cole Jr, Joseph Cole, Sarah Cole, William Jesse Cole. Reverend John Cole passed away in 1808 in Bush River, Newberry, South Carolina, USA.
